Output e2c5312d31e5037b800e24c12a2c71fcab06c00190f80cc4d67682a9a5599730:18

value
429502721
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d823805d6cfe2f76532b12bc7e9d4f36be85cd9c OP_EQUAL
address
MTbziYjDu6ACYTDkwmzeiS8rK6KPRMXPZc
transaction
e2c5312d31e5037b800e24c12a2c71fcab06c00190f80cc4d67682a9a5599730
spent
true